    Purpose

    Outline Criteria for Rig Move surveying activities, including Jacking Up / Down Operations.

    Clarify the roles of the Marine Warranty Surveyor, the Assured & the Underwriter.

    Define the function of the respective Scope(s) of Work.

    Establish guidelines for communication between the parties.

    Rig Move Warranty Survey. Outline criteria

    Defined Jack-Up Rig Activities.

    Wet tows exceeding 24 hours duration.

    Dry tow / HLV Transportation.

    Transits under own power.

    3

    Activity Criteria Marine Warranty Surveyor

    Work scope

    Jack-Up Rig Activities Established Oil and Gas Field

    Area where Operator and/orMarine Warranty Survey

    Company is aware of any of

    the following:

    - previous incidence of

    punch-through within the

    field

    - existing jack-up footprint

    with different rig

    - Where there have been

    known problems (leg splaying

    etc.)

    - Or if Assured has reason to

    believe that a punch- through

    risk and/ or shallow gas risk

    might exist

    - Or if in a field or area with

    no previous Jack-Up activity

    SOW 1

    Wet Tows of Jack-Up Rigs/Lift

    Barges/Semi-Submersible and

    Submersible MODUs/Drill Ship

    Tows exceeding 24 hrs

    duration

    SOW 2

    Dry Tows / HLV Transportation

    of Jack-Up Rigs/Lift

    Barges/Semi-Submersible and

    Submersible MODUs

    All activities SOW 3

    Transits of Lift Barges / Semi-

    Submersible and Submersible

    MODUs and tender rigs under

    their own power

    Exceeding 72 hrs duration To be recommended by

    Marine Warranty Surveyor on

    a risk assessed basis and

    agreed by Contract Leader(s)

    Rig Move Warranty Survey outline criteria

    (contd)

    Criteria met, coverage is conditional upon: (a) MWS appointment by the Assured from an agreed panel, (b)Application of the specific SOW (c) Issuance of a Certificate of Approval

    Duty of the Assured to ensure compliance with all recommendations.

    MWS survey to be conducted in accordance with COP & SOW.

    Cost of the MWS to be borne by the Assured (Survey Allowance still available).

    MWS shall be free to consult with the Underwriters.

    Code of Practice

    Clarifies the roles of the Parties.

    Establishes minimum standards for MWS performance.

    Defines lines of communication between the parties.

    Role of the Marine Warranty Surveyor

    Make reasonable endeavours to ensure risks are reduced to an acceptable level.

    Only appoint personnel who are demonstrably competent.

    Specify the recommendations to be met in order to minimise risk.

    Ensure operations are conducted in accordance with recognised design & industry practice, Unitsoperating manual, & MWS relevant guidelines & carry out suitability surveys of vessels, structures &equipment.

    Upon being satisfied that objectives are met, issue a COA, identifying recommendations to be satisfied.

    The MWS shall not provide any other services that may present a conflict of interest or interfere with thework of the MWS.

    Advise the Contract leader (i) If any COA is withheld, (ii) Non compliance with any Recommendations, (iii)changes to MWS key personnel.

    Role of the Assured

    Once appointed, MWS not to be changed without Contract Leaders agreement.

    Provide Marine Warranty Surveyor with a point of contact within the assureds' organisation, and a point ofcontact for the Contract leader.

    Provide the Contract Leader with MWS contact details.

    Provide the MWS with Contract leader details.

    Ensure Marine Warranty Surveyor participation at all relevant project management meetings.

    Role of the Underwriters

    Agree panel of Marine Warranty Surveyors.

    At request of Marine Warranty Surveyor, make available:

    - Relevant policy terms, conditions, and Warranty provisions

    - Contact details of Contract leaders.

    Broker responses / comments

    U/W's should pay for MWS - No change expected, of the common practice of underwriters allowing costreturns. (Survey allowance).

    Why is duration criteria now Hours vs mileage ? - Reliability of Weather forecasting arrangements.

    U/Ws free to agree changes to duration criteria.

    U/W's/ MWS communication should be via Insured &/or Broker, not solely U/Ws/MWS. - Can be if soagreed/Clear communication/Speed of response/As existing CAR COP.

    Insured to select from agreed MWS Panel. - U/W's agree panel. Insured free to select from the panel. Anychanges TBA by U/Ws.

    Role of Insured - too many tasks. - U/W's will consider particular circumstances.

    Broker to provide policy etc. details to MWS - not U/W's. - Only at MWS request to U/W's. No bar onBrokers providing such information. As existing CAR/COP.

    High level of detail. Should be a generic structure, capable of variation to suit particular risks. - That isthe intention. Variations can be agreed between the parties.

    Expectation that established procedures should govern the relationship. - Not looking to "re invent", butintroduce standard and consistent procedures, which are largely in place now.

    We like the SOW Tables. Would be great if MWS adopted these! / All this looks sensible !

    Sum Up

    Why required - Past Rig losses & near misses. Standard MWS Rig COP/SOW designed to clarifyroles/responsibilities of the parties, and reduce risk to an acceptable level.

    Benefits: Clarity of role(s), Clear, standard SOW, addressing the root causes of past losses/near misses.

    New Rig scope similar in concept to CAR MWS COP/SOW, which widely adopted.

    COP requirements make sense in defining roles & obligations of the parties.

    SOW requirements follow present good industry practice. (MWS confirm these practices presentlyadopted).

    The Criteria in the Rig Move Warranty, and SOW itself, provides a consistent generic framework that canbe tailored to suit the particular risk.

    What Next ?

    Rig move COP/SOW now ready for release to the market
